A taxi ride from Dubai International Airport to The Walk at JBR typically costs between AED 100 to AED 130, depending on traffic and the time of day. This journey covers approximately 35 kilometers and takes about 30 to 45 minutes. For a smooth experience, it’s advisable to book a taxi through the airport’s official taxi service, which ensures safety and reliability.

What Factors Affect Taxi Fares in Dubai?
Several factors can influence the cost of your taxi ride from the airport to The Walk:
- Traffic Conditions: Peak hours and traffic congestion can increase travel time and fares.
- Time of Day: Nighttime rides may incur additional charges due to higher base fares.
- Type of Taxi: Standard taxis are generally cheaper than luxury or larger vehicle options.

How to Book a Taxi from Dubai Airport?
Booking a taxi from Dubai Airport is straightforward. Upon arrival, follow these steps:
- Exit the Terminal: Follow signs to the taxi stand located outside each terminal.
- Choose Your Taxi Type: Decide between a standard or luxury taxi based on your preference and budget.
- Confirm Your Destination: Clearly state "The Walk at JBR" to your driver to ensure accurate navigation.

How Long Does It Take to Travel from Dubai Airport to The Walk?
The journey from Dubai International Airport to The Walk typically takes 30 to 45 minutes. This duration can vary depending on traffic conditions, especially during peak hours.
Is There a Cheaper Alternative to Taxis for This Route?
Yes, public transportation options like the Dubai Metro and buses are available and more economical. However, they require transfers and may take longer than a direct taxi ride.
Are Taxis in Dubai Safe and Reliable?
Dubai taxis are known for their safety and reliability. All official taxis are regulated by the Roads and Transport Authority (RTA), ensuring high standards of service and vehicle maintenance.
Can I Pay for Taxis in Dubai with a Credit Card?
Most taxis in Dubai accept credit card payments, but it’s advisable to confirm with the driver before starting your journey. Cash payments in AED are also widely accepted.
